📖 What is Greenland 2: Migration About?

Having found the safety of the Greenland bunker after the comet Clarke decimated the Earth, the Garrity family must now risk everything to embark on a perilous journey across the wasteland of Europe to find a new home.

Production & Box Office Performance

With a budget of $90,000,000, Greenland 2: Migration has grossed $44,856,736, indicating a moderate box office success. The film's production quality is evident in its well-crafted set pieces and special effects, which effectively convey the devastation wrought by the comet Clarke.
